Understanding Variance and Risk Tolerance

While RTP is a key factor, it’s equally important to understand the concept of variance. Variance refers to the level of fluctuation in payouts. A game with high variance may offer large payouts, but these are less frequent. Conversely, a game with low variance offers smaller, more consistent payouts. The chicken road gambling game strikes a balance between variance and RTP, providing a combination of substantial potential rewards with a relatively high probability of success. The four difficulty levels adjust this variance, allowing players to tailor the experience to their risk tolerance. Players who prefer a more cautious approach might opt for easier difficulties, while those seeking higher thrills can embrace the challenges of hardcore mode.
